A living product that demands tight logistics

Microgreens are living products. Their quality depends directly on the time between harvest and use.

That's why a structured delivery schedule matters so much. Twice-weekly deliveries maintain steady freshness without overloading your kitchen storage.

The shorter the gap, the more vibrant, precise and usable the product stays on your plates.

Two formats, two uses in the kitchen

Depending on how your kitchen operates, two formats may be relevant:

  • substrate-grown microgreens: they stay alive longer and maintain peak freshness. Ideal for keeping a stable product over several days.
  • pre-cut microgreens: ready to use, they allow fast plating during service.

The right choice depends on your workflow, but in both cases, initial quality is what makes the difference.
